Web22 jun. 2016 · Here’s a brief history of how batteries have changed over the years: Voltaic Pile (1799) Italian physicist Alessandro Volta, in 1799, … WebPeople have been using wind energy for thousands of years. People used wind energy to propel boats along the Nile River as early as 5,000 BC. By 200 BC, simple wind-powered water pumps were used in China, and windmills with woven-reed blades were grinding grain in Persia and the Middle East. New ways to use wind energy eventually spread around ...
